An exquisitely detailed funeral tribute shows the Union Jack completely rendered in flowers, shaped into a flat, rectangular panel yet appearing softly raised due to the dense layering of blooms. The arrangement is set against a plain white background, allowing the floral design to take centre stage without distraction. Deep blue flowers, gathered closely together, form the background in each corner and trace a narrow frame around the entire piece, their cool tones and tight clusters creating a calm, unified base. From the middle of this blue field, the red St George's Cross stretches boldly up and down, side to side, composed of compact red blossoms whose rounded petals nestle tightly in all directions. Diagonal red bands cross over these central lines, depicting the St Patrick's Cross with precise symmetry and well-defined angles. Encasing all the red elements is a network of clean white lines made from small, crisp blooms, capturing the fimbriation and suggesting the broader St Andrew's Cross beneath. These white sections act almost like brushstrokes of light, clearly separating the strong red from the cool blue and preserving the familiar pattern of the national flag. The entire surface has a quilted, cushion-like texture, inviting the thought of gentle touch while maintaining a mood of respect and formality.
